This frosty drink did not begin with those three ingredients, though. The word "milkshake" appeared in print for the first time in 1885. The concoction of cream, eggs, and whiskey was often served with other alcoholic beverages, such as lemonades and soda waters..
By 1900, a milkshake had often referred to "healthy drinks made with chocolate, strawberry, or vanilla syrups." ice cream was nowhere to be found in these frothy beverages. However, a few years ago in the early 1900s, people were still craving this new treat with a scoop of ice cream. Malt shops were serving milkshakes all over the United States by the 1930s..
